Обсуждения

Пдскажите по интеграции форума с WP

Есть задача сделать форум в вордпрессе. С плагином simple-forum у меня что-то не заладилось, да и последнего перевода (версии 2.1) нет 🙁

В идеале, хотелось бы SMF форум или такой же как и здесь, но только использующий те же имена пользователей, куки и сессии, что и Вордпресс (насколько я понял, здесь надо регистрироваться отдельно), чтобы была одна форма авторизации.

Ваша база данных WordPress устарела

Помогите пожалуйста. Читал все readme и пр. и ничего не нашел про сам процесс преобразования базы.
Как это можно сделать?

Если этого не сделать то wordpress выдает:
WordPress database error: [Table ‘u121212.wp_categories’ doesn’t exist]
SELECT * FROM wp_categories ORDER BY cat_ID

WordPress database error: [Table ‘u121212.wp_post2cat’ doesn’t exist]
SELECT post_id, category_id FROM wp_post2cat GROUP BY post_id, category_id

WordPress database error: [Table ‘u121212.wp_link2cat’ doesn’t exist]
SELECT link_id, category_id FROM wp_link2cat GROUP BY link_id, category_id

совместимость плагинов

бороться со спамом ето приоритет для всех… был у меня такой плагин spamviewer, вчера нашел и такой peters-custom-anti-spam-image. интерсно магу ли я использовать их обоих одновременно?

Нужен плагин – Афиша

Привет всем! Нужен плагин или идея как организовать на сайте основанном на wordpress что-то типа афиши, то есть чтобы можно было сделать раздел где бы выводился календарь на мероприятия с описанием каждого мероприятия.
Заранее спасибо за помощь!

Подскажите плагин для создания версий страниц для печати

Привет всем!
Подскажите, плиз, плагин для создания версий страниц для печати. Пробовал зайти на snowballblog, автор которого публиковал перевод такого плагина, но сайт не работает.
Еще подскажите, пожалйста, какой адрес будут иметь страицы для печати и как их лучше закрыть от индексации.
Заранее спасибо!

Во все файлы index.php добавляется вредоносный код

Проблема следующего характера во все файлы с названием index.php добавляется вредоносный код. Версия движка 2.2.3.
Как сделать так что-бы это не происходило?
Вариант обновиться не предлагать.

Заранее спасибо тем кто поможет в решении моей проблемы.

Учет переходов по внешным сылкам

Как сделать учет переходов по внешным сылкам.
Если такой плагин, который ведет статистику внешних переходов.

WP-DownloadManager

Вопрос. А как с помощью этого плагина добавить например одну конкретную ссылку на файл со статистикой в пост. Не парился б и установил Дбютифул да он не хочет работать в последний версии вордпреса
http://lesterchan.net/wordpress/readme/wp-downloadmanager.html

Помогите в оптимизации сайта!

Очень долго грузится сайт в чем может быть проблема? сайт http://www.littledogs.ru Что делать?

Рубрики в обеих колонках сразу

у меня трехкнопочная тема (виджеты поддерживает), я хочу, чтобы на правом сайдбаре отображались одни рубрики, а на левой колонке – другие, без дублирования тех, что на правой. Такое возможно? Если да, то как? WP 2.3.1. И еще как сделать, чтобы на главной странице появлялись записи только из определенной рубрики?

Показывать только для админа

Не раз, наверняка, пользователи WordPress задавались вопросом – а как бы сделать так, что бы некую информацию видел только я (администратор)? Сегодня расскажу о паре решений. Работает на WP выше 2.0More…

Способ первый – совсем несложный

Качаем http://www.daikos.net/widgets/daikos-text-widget/. Это такая замечетельная штука, которая может обрабатывать PHP. Активируем виджет в плагинах. Идем Внешний вид – Виджеты и переносим появивщийся виджет на ваш сайдбар. Если вы уже используете встроенные виджеты Текст для отображения, например, счетчиков или чег-нибудь подобного, то копируем из него всю информацию и вставляем ее в наш Daiko’s Text Widget. Затаем снизу (или сверху, как больше нравиться) добавляем

<?php if (current_user_can('level_10')) { ?>
Только для админа
<?php } ?>

Достоинства
– просто и почти ничего не нужно делать.
Недостатки
-если не придумать, куда засунуть скрываемую инфу – придется делать отдельный виджет – а это не всегда красиво.

Способ второй – сложнее, но интереснее

Второй сайдбар. Открываем в папке вашей темы файл sidebar.php. Там скорее всего почти сразу натыкаемся на

<?php if ( !function_exists('dynamic_sidebar') || !dynamic_sidebar() ) : ?>

Или что то похожее. Это нично иное как начало регистрации нашего сайдбара. В скобочках добавляем 1 получается

<?php if ( !function_exists('dynamic_sidebar') || !dynamic_sidebar(1) ) : ?>

и выше (думаю админский сайдбар будет у вас именно выше) добавляем

<?php if (current_user_can('level_10')) { if ( !function_exists('dynamic_sidebar') || !dynamic_sidebar(2) ) : ?><?php endif; }?>

Но это еще не все. Так работать не будет. Сохраняем наш sidebar.php, открываем functions.php который лежит рядом и находим нечто подобное (данный код из взят из дефолтной темы)

if ( function_exists('register_sidebar') )
register_sidebar(array(
'before_widget' => '<li id="%1$s" class="widget %2$s">',
'after_widget' => '</li>',
'before_title' => '<h2 class="widgettitle">',
'after_title' => '</h2>',
));

Копируем, вставляем чуть ниже еще раз и в каждую функцию добавляем по строче с названием. Получается так

if ( function_exists('register_sidebar') )
register_sidebar(array(
'name' => 'Админ',
'before_widget' => '<li id="%1$s" class="widget %2$s">',
'after_widget' => '</li>',
'before_title' => '<h2 class="widgettitle">',
'after_title' => '</h2>',
));

Имя – какое угодно. К примеру для "Обычный сайдбар" и "Админский сайдбар" Плюсы такого решения очевидны – можно на второй сайдбар положить все что угодно – несколько rss лент, которые интересны лично вам и не имеют никакого отношения к вашим посетителям, какие то ссылки, которые всегда нужны под рукой, да мало ли что еще. И ничего не путается – все строго по сайдбарам.

И все 🙂 Следует помнить, что, некоторую информацию, например счетчики прятать просто нельзя – иначе в статистике будут использоваться только администраторские визиты на сайт.

Счетчик просмотров конкретной страницы

Банально, но нчиего подходячего найти не могу – нужен счетчик, который бы отображал кол-во просмотров отдельно взятой страницы ….

удобное и красивое оформление кода

создается сайт со статьями на двиге вордпресса. на нем будут выкладываться php\перл\прочие коды.
подскажите каким образом можно красиво это оформить в посте. если код большой страница разъезжается сильно и некрасиво. в идеале нравится оформление как в булке, когда код заключается в [_code][_/code] без "_"
пример:

function CheckPass($pop3server, $username, $pass)
{
  global $pop3port;
  $fp = fsockopen($pop3server, $pop3port, $errno, $errstr, 30);
  if (!$fp) 
    return false;
  $buf = fgets($fp, 128);
  if ($buf[0] != "+")
    {
      fclose($fp);
      return false;
    }
  fputs($fp,"user ".$username."\r\n");
  $buf = fgets($fp, 128);
  if ($buf[0] != "+")
    {
      fclose($fp);
      return false;
    }
  fputs($fp,"pass ".$pass."\r\n");
  $buf = fgets($fp, 128);
  if (strlen($buf) > 3 && $buf[0] == "+")
    {
      fclose($fp);
      return true;
    }
  fclose($fp);
  return false;
}

function genstr($l, $alf)
{
  $result = "";
  for ($i=0;$i<$l;$i++)
    $result .= $alf[0];
  return $result;
}

function nextpass($p, $alf)
{
  for ($i=0;$i<strlen($p);$i++)
    {
      if (strpos($alf,$p[$i]) ==  strlen($alf)-1)
        {
          $p[$i] = $alf[0];
        }
      else
        {
          $p[$i] = $alf[strpos($alf,$p[$i])+1];
          return $p;
        }
    }
  $p .= $alf[0];
  return $p;
}

if (isset($_POST["name"]))
  {
     if ($_POST["name"] === "")
      {
        echo "Отсутствует имя</body></html>";
        exit;
      }
     if (!isset($servers[$_POST["popserver"]]))
      {
        echo "Неправильно задан pop3 сервер</body></html>";
        exit;
      }

и в результате будет окно всегда одного размера и в нем будет весь код, так же если он большой то будет прокрутка в этом окошке.
как сделать что подобное на вп?

Вопрос по работе WordPress???

Установил WordPress на локальном сервере Denwer,
установилось нормально без ошибок.
Но когда запускаю в браузере свой сайт wp.ru,
то не появляется тема WP , и не могу зайти в админ-панель,
когда ввожу пароль, то выдает следующее сообщение:
"ОШИБКА: WordPress использует cookies, а ваш браузер их либо не поддерживает, либо блокирует."
Но настройка браузеров нормальная, и это сообщение во всех браузерах Opera,IE,FF.
Никаких файрвойлов не стоит, и антивирусников тоже.
И еще , когда щелкаю по ссылке, то в адресной строке появляется следующее,
"http://wp.ru/wp-login.php"
т.е. два раза прописывается адрес.
Help, подскажите кто может.!

Если где то это уже обсуждалось? но я не нашел.
Если обсуждалось то можно удалить пост,
дайте ссылку на обсуждение.

Lightbox + div-тема

Народ, скажите, а lightbox не дружит с блочной версткой?
При нажатии на картинку – увеличенное изображение открывается ниже сайта.
Т.е. сначала идет серый background, а потом картинка

Постинг с картинкиами и их автосохранением

Всем здрасте
вот такой вопрос
например я скоприровал новость на каком-то сайте с текстом и картинками в буфер
в стандартом редакторе вордпресса
можно вставить это в свой сайт – но картинки не будут скопированы ко мне
ссылки будут идти на сайт оригинал
мне бы хотелось чтоб картинки копировались и ссылки подменялись на локальные
есть ли такой плагин ?
я перепробовал кучу плагитнов ….
везде надо вручную – скопировать картинку – добавить на сайт – вставить в пост …..
жжжжуть…
на других CMS системах есть подобные фичи для простого постинга

ЗЫ – мой сайт исключительно в локалке без выхода в инте
поэтому это очень актуально…

Мои проблемы, нужна ВАША помощь!

Всем привет! Если админы не против, то я в этой теме буду выкладывать все свои проблемы с WP.

Немного о том что уже есть: установил WP 2.3.1
скачал тему: сейчас занимаюсь её руссификацией.

Проблемы: 1)Когда пользуюсь поиском по сайту выдаёт вот такие пути http://***.ru/index.php?s=%D0%BF%D1%80%D0%B8%D0%B2%D0%B5%D1%82&Submit=Search

А хотелось бы чтобы писалось что запрашивается.

WP-LOGIN в дизайне сайта без редиректа в админку

Подскажите, как сделать возможность юзерам просто логиниться, не попадая в админку сайта?
Плюс сама форма для залогинивания должна быть в дизайне сайта – Т/е/ прямо на одной из страниц и после залогинивания человек должен попадать на главную…
Зараннее всем спасибо!

Проблема с удаленной публикацией в блог!

Дело обстоит так!

В качестве блог-клиента использую Windows Live Writer. Никаких проблем обычно не возникает. Однако с переодичностью раз в месяц случается такой глюк: при попытке добавить запись в блог или при запросе опубликованного материала с блога – выскакивает ошибка подключения в файле xmlrpc.php. Думал, может сайт в дауне -проверил, все нормально!
(Кстати, через ту же прогу в любое время можно получить доступ к редактированию блога. Все отлично соединяется!).

Случалось так уже пару раз! Проходит, как правило, на следующий день! Но все же… Время то идет….

Может у кого-то были подобные траблы. Поделитесь, пожалуйста!

Спасибо!

Как сделать вот такую галерею?

Вот ссылка: http://www.rebenki.ru/fotki-fotki/
Чтобы был точно также альбом-в нем подразделы-а в них фотки, тыкаешь по фотке она открывается на черном фоне, вообщем все как там.
Какой нужно плагин? Заранее спасибо!

Anonymous
Отправить
Ответ на: